Have you ever wondered about the distinction between a Slack bot and a Slack app and how they can streamline your workflow and team communication?
In this blog post, we're going to break down the specifics of these unique concepts, explore examples of both, and explain how they can supercharge your productivity in Slack.

According to Slack, A bot is a type of Slack App designed to interact with users via conversation.
A Slack Bot is the same as a regular Slack app: in terms of API access and all of the other things a Slack app can do.

So they can be built to do things like automatically respond to certain keywords or phrases, manage and schedule meetings, handle reminders, or even integrate with other services.
Note that to create a Slack bot, you need to create/have a Slack app first.
Some bots are pre-built and provided by Slack or third-party developers, while others can be custom-built to suit the specific needs of a workspace.
A Slack app is a broader concept that can include bots but also includes other types of functionality. They are third-party applications that you can integrate into your Slack workspace to extend the functionality of Slack.
A Slack app can include a bot, but it might also include interactive messages, message buttons, and menus or might even provide a complete interactive user interface within Slack.

The main difference between a Slack bot and a Slack app is that a bot is specifically a program that automates tasks and interactions within Slack, often responding to specific commands or events, while a Slack app is a broader category that includes bots but can also include other types of functionality and integrations.
In essence, all Slack bots can be considered part of Slack apps, but not all Slack apps are bots. For example, an app might simply post notifications into a Slack channel from another service, like alerts from a bug tracking system or updates from a calendar, without having any interactive or automated behavior that would characterize it as a bot.
